For the energy levels in an atom which one of the following statements is correct?

A

The 4s sub-energy level is at a higher energy than the 3d sub-energy level

B

The M-energy level can have maximum of 32 electrons

C

The second principal energy level can have four orbitals and contain a maximum of 8 electrons

D

The `5^(th)` main energy level can have maximum of 72 electrons

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
C
